What Happened

Viral TikTok trends were ranked and critiqued by Ben Shapiro, with hilarity and skepticism being key elements of the discussion. Shapiro began with the owl trend, which involved mimicking an owl with cultural twists. He found it mildly amusing but ultimately saw it as a way to sum up a culture in a single syllable.

The tortilla slap challenge was seen as one of the more entertaining trends. Participants slap each other with tortillas while holding water in their mouths, creating a humorous and non-threatening scenario. Shapiro suggested this could be a light-hearted way to engage political opponents, noting its potential for amusing content.

Another trend involved quizzing spouses on famous athletes, revealing gaps in celebrity knowledge. Shapiro related this to personal experiences, mentioning his wife's initial unfamiliarity with political figures like Mitt Romney. He found the trend amusing and indicative of how different interests shape knowledge.

The show also touched on the Mary Poppins challenge, where participants pull unexpectedly large objects from bags. Shapiro found humor in the absurdity of the challenge and compared it to pulling out increasingly larger items, noting its potential for comedic effect.

A less favored trend involved a dangerous form of fishing with large hooks, which Shapiro criticized for its recklessness. He expressed disdain for the practice, linking it to irresponsible behavior and noting its potential use in life insurance advertisements.

Overall, Shapiro found the TikTok trends to be a mix of entertaining and bewildering, often highlighting the creativity and absurdity that social media can inspire. He concluded that while some trends were amusing, they also reflect a society with too much free time.
